Ibuprofen is a medication used to relieve the pain, tenderness, inflammation (swelling), and stiffness caused by arthritis and gout. This document presents information about ibuprofen, including why the medication is prescribed, how the medicine should be used, what special precautions to follow before taking ibuprofen. The document also provides side effects from ibuprofen, storage conditions needed for the medicine, and a list of prescription medicines that contain ibuprofen.
